Solar PV generation increased by a record 270 TWh (up 26%) in 2022, reaching almost 1 300 TWh. It demonstrated the largest absolute generation growth of all renewable technologies in 2022, surpassing wind for the first time in history.

Lifespan of Solar Panels: A Comprehensive Guide 2024
Typically, the lifespan of solar panels is anywhere from 25 to 30 years, making them a remarkably durable component of solar photovoltaic (PV) systems. This longevity surpasses that of many other household systems, such as boilers, which usually have a life expectancy of 10 to 15 years.

How Long Do Solar Panels Last on a House? | Solar
Solar panels have a productive lifespan of 25 to 30 years, and can continue to produce cheap electricity much longer than that. In fact, many of the first residential solar panels installed in the 1980''s are still performing at effective levels, according to the Solar Energy Industries Association (SEIA).

Operating lifetime and disposal of solar panels
There is no single universal defining standard determining the lifetime of solar panels. The oldest operating solar power plant is over 60 years old. Even though most manufacturers today advertise a guaranteed lifetime of 25 years. The averaged estimates, however, show that the real service life of the installation can be as long as 40–50 years.

How long do solar panels last? A lifespan guide
In general, their lifespan ranges between 25 and 30 years, with monocrystalline models typically lasting over 30 years. Many manufacturers offer warranties that protect the solar panels for at least half of their expected lifespan, with a guarantee that performance won''t drop below a specified level during that time.

Solar power
Solar power, also known as solar electricity, is the conversion of energy from sunlight into electricity, either directly using photovoltaics (PV) or indirectly using concentrated solar power. How long does a solar inverter last?
To serve their purpose, solar panels need an inverter of energy for domestic use. Such a device, called an inverter, has a service life of approximately 10 years, and in rare cases, up to 20 years. So the possibility of replacing it independently at any time does not limit the overall lifetim e of PV installations.
How much energy does a solar panel produce a year?
This decrease in efficiency, known as degradation, typically occurs at a rate of about 0.5% to 1% annually. Consequently, after 25 years, you can expect solar panels to produce approximately 75% to 87.5% of the power output they initially provided when they were new.
